Useful Considerations Before You Upload
Before you use the Cats 2 Journal Interior for publishing, take a moment to review the trim size and page count. This product is designed for 8 x 10 inches and 100 pages, which is a popular size for notebooks and journals. Confirm that your chosen POD platform supports this trim size, and ensure your cover template matches the interior dimensions exactly. Most platforms provide cover templates based on page count and paper type, so use those to avoid alignment issues.
If you plan to use the interior for personal printing, check your printer's capabilities. An 8 x 10 inch page may require trimming if your printer uses standard letter or A4 paper. Many print shops offer cutting services, or you can use a paper trimmer at home for a clean edge.
Because the product includes 60 files, you have room to experiment. Print a sample page or two before committing to a full run. This helps you confirm that the spacing, line weight, and overall feel match your expectations. Small adjustments at the testing stage can prevent larger issues later.
